Building a team from scratch is hard, especially if we have nobody to guide us. What should we know about building a team and leveraging systems? Is money the only measure of success in real estate? In this episode, Todd Tramonte shares his path of how he built a successful team and what we can learn from his journey. If you are the best technician in your business, you don’t really have a good business -Todd Tramonte 3 Things We Learned From This Episode Put systems in place to maximize your productivity before making hires (09:30:12-20) Many team leaders make the mistake of hiring more agents, and end up being overstaffed, when what they actually need is to be more productive. When we don’t have systems in place, our agents’ efforts will be scattered, and their productivity levels will drop. This is not because they are understaffed, but because they are overwhelmed by not having a clear roadmap and a system to follow. Chase freedom, not money (14:50-15-33) Nobody wants money. We want what the money will get us. Many agents are handcuffed to the money and have no time for the things that matter. Investing our time in cross-training and focusing on the growth of agents will allow us to delegate some of the responsibilities and get more time for ourselves and families. Be perseverant in your follow-up (41:40-32:45) Don’t think of yourself as someone who annoys prospects with messages and calls. We have a solution to their problem-- they just don’t know about it yet. Have a system in place, and don’t be afraid to make phone calls or send messages because our clients will be the ones who get the most out of it if they hire us. We shouldn’t get handcuffed to our business. We can prevent it by investing time in the education and cross-training of our agents. Don’t allow only one person in the business to “hold the keys”, even if that person is yourself. This is the start of how we step out of production and into more time for ourselves and our families. This is a unique Texas Home Improvement broadcast as this weekend instead of doing his typical shows in Dallas and Houston, Jim was on the air for 10 hours in Houston on KTRH as part of their After the Storm coverage. He took dozens of calls from listeners throughout South Texas as they shared their stories and asked questions about their extraordinary circumstances. He came away inspired by the resiliency of these Texans who are ready to put in the work to get their lives back. He also was witness to the recurring theme of this devastating storm which is neighbor helping neighbor as we are all in this together. This podcast is a sampling of some of the calls he took including: cleaning up after flooding, treating your home for mold and bacteria, caring for rental properties, hiring a contractor, options for those without flood insurance, second floor apartments when the first floor was flooded and more.
There is value in treating your team like your own clients. How do you bring world class value to the people who work for and with you? What is the agent-in-training program and how does it help people find their roles? What are the three pillars you can build into your team recruitment? On this episode, we are joined by Todd Tramonte, who shares on team management and using radio as a direct response marketing tool. You can only do branding on the back of direct response and lead generation -Todd Tramonte Takeaways + Tactics - Put people in specific roles where their "stress-response" is the right response for their role. - Use an "Agent-in-Training" model to help people get into their proper role and make mistakes in a low-pressure environment. - Before you provide leads to team members, you need to decide what kind of team you want. At the start of the show, Todd shared on his systems, and how he identifies people’s spectrum of giftedness. Next, we talked about the agent-in-training program and why it’s so important to help people fit into where they are most talented and effective. Todd also talked about how his company uses radio for direct response and not for branding. Towards the end of the show, he shared on targeting through radio. We also spoke about:- The three pillars he puts into his recruitment - Serving and delivering value as a leader - How to lead companies that people love staying in When it comes to recruiting the right people, it helps if people start out with that desire and hustle on their own. There’s always an opportunity if someone is great. As a leader, you have a responsibility to provide value to your team members, and looking at team members as clients you have to serve and deliver value to, not because you’re afraid of losing them but because it’s your duty as a leader.
